Rejecting stray magnetic fields in Hall-effect-based current sensors using the ACS724
Published
Watch video explaining and demonstrating a method for rejecting stray magnetic fields in Hall-effect-based current sensors using the ACS724. This technology solves interference and cross-talk issues, greatly simplifying the use of magnetic current sensors in magnetically noisy environments, such as motor control, solenoid drivers, etc.
ACS712 Low-Noise 2100 VRMS Hall-Effect Current Sensor IC
Published
The Allegro ACS712 provides economical and precise solutions for AC or DC current sensing in industrial, commercial, and communications systems. The device package allows for easy implementation by the customer. Typical applications include motor control, load detection and management, switched-mode power supplies, and overcurrent fault protection.
